A tracheostomy is a surgical procedure that creates an artificial opening into the trachea, typically at the second or third cartilaginous ring level. This opening allows the insertion of a tracheostomy tube, which can replace an endotracheal tube, provide mechanical ventilation, bypass an upper airway obstruction, or remove accumulated tracheobronchial secretions.

Pediatric tracheostomy care updates.

Matthew M Smith1,2,3, Dan Benscoter4,2,5, Catherine K Hart1,2,3

  • 1Division of Pediatric Otolaryngology - Head and Neck Surgery.

Current Opinion in Otolaryngology & Head and Neck Surgery
|October 7, 2020
PubMed
Summary
This summary is machine-generated.

This review updates pediatric tracheostomy care, highlighting recent advances in managing skin breakdown, tube changes, and team-based education. Telemedicine is emerging as a key tool for optimizing care in these children.

Area of Science:

  • Pediatric Otolaryngology
  • Respiratory Medicine
  • Pediatric Critical Care

Background:

  • Pediatric tracheostomies are crucial for managing airway issues in children.
  • Effective management requires ongoing attention to potential complications and care optimization.

Purpose of the Study:

  • To provide an updated overview of current best practices in pediatric tracheostomy management.
  • To synthesize recent literature on optimizing care for children with tracheostomies.

Main Methods:

  • Literature review of recent publications on pediatric tracheostomy care.
  • Synthesis of findings related to various aspects of tracheostomy management.

Main Results:

  • Recent literature emphasizes preventing and managing skin breakdown.
  • Optimal timing for tracheostomy tube changes and surveillance endoscopy is discussed.
  • Multidisciplinary team-based approaches and telemedicine are highlighted for improved care.

Conclusions:

  • A systematic, team-based approach focused on quality improvement is essential.
  • Implementing these strategies can significantly enhance the quality of care for pediatric tracheostomy patients.
